Monday, December 17, 2012

NASA Probes Crash Into Moon

The Daily Mail reports that NASA has crashed the "Ebb" and "Flow" probes into a mountain side on the Moon. The site of the crash will be named after Sally Ride, the first American woman to go into space, who died earlier this year.

